2013 Advanced Woodie Camp

If you are interested in signing up your child that has attended Woodie Camp for our Advanced Camp, please contact Brad Nylin ASAP at brad.nylin@mnwaterfowl.com

The registration requirements for our Advanced Woodie Camp is now open, and we only have room for 12 kids. This is a first come, first serve Advanced Camp, so when I get to 12 kids, we will start a waiting list. 

The cost to attend Advanced Camp is $300.

The Dates for Advanced Camp will be over MEA break from school, October 17 - 19, 2013. 

All kids that attend this Advanced Camp, must have attended Woodie Camp prior to 2013. 

All attendees will be responsible for bringing their own ammunition and trasportation to and from the location. 

Location for Advanced Woodie Camp: Viking Valley Hunt Club, near Ashby, MN. 

Once you contact me, I will follow up with details and what to plan for. The kids will be hunting ducks over water, geese in fields and pheasant hunting as well as sporting clays. This is a really great experience for the kids and they are sure to have a great time!

2012 Advanced Woodie Camp

October 18, 19 and 20, 2012

2012 Advanced Woodie Camp was held October 18 - 20, 2012 over MEA break. We had 13 kids participate and 9 mentors. The kids all came from all parts of the state, and had a terrific time. The weather wasn't great, but that's hunting. All the kids got to shoot at wild birds, ducks and / or geese. Plus they all shot 5-stand (clay targets) and they got to go on a pheasant hunt with lots of pheasants. What a great experience and a better time. 

It was really neat to see the kids so excited about the entire "duck camp" weekend, and to see them jump right back into getting to know each other again.
